Dawsongroup is one of Europe's leading asset rental businesses, operating across trucks, vans, buses and coaches, material handling, municipal, temperature control, finance, and energy solutions. Operating for over 90 years as a family business, we still adhere to the values that guided us for so long, now under the ownership of KKR, with continued investment in our people, infrastructure, and future growth. With operations across the UK and internationally, our culture is built around accountability, collaboration, growth, and continuous improvement.
